TAMPA — Three men were arrested Monday night after police patrolling Robles Park Village caught them in a drive-by shooting, police said.
The shooting was reported about 11 p.m. near Lake and Central avenues when police officers saw a gray Crown Victoria approach the intersection. The men inside fired several rounds out of the window before heading west on E Lake Avenue, Tampa police said.
The officers pursued the car, which crashed near Indiana and Florida avenues. The three men inside ran away from the car.
One shooter was quickly arrested. The others continued to run. A K-9 eventually located them hiding under two houses in the 3600 block of Arlington Avenue.
Officers recovered the Crown Victoria, stolen in Hillsborough County, and two firearms.
The shooters were identified as Deeric Moore, 18, Floyd Rivers, 27, and James Scott, 16. They face charges that include obstructing an officer and trespassing.
